#f172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f172ce is composed of 94.5% red, 44.7%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 316.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 69.6%. #f172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#e3009d.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f172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f172ce has RGB values of R:241, G:114,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.15,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15823566.

Shades and Tints of #f172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f172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5aeb3 is the less saturated color, while #fd66d3 is the most saturated one.
